Inclusion criteria

Inclusion criteria: Criteria for inclusion of patients in the IGOS: • Fulfil the diagnostic criteria for GBS of the National Institute of Neurological Disorders and Stroke (NINDS). In addition all patients with Miller Fisher syndrome (MFS) and other variants of GBS, including overlap syndromes can be included, for which additional diagnostic criteria will be provided. • Inclusion of all males and females of all ages, independent of disease severity and treatment • Inclusion within two weeks of onset of weakness. In IGOS-Kids, children should be included within four weeks of onset of weakness. In IGOS-Infections, patients should be included within 8 weeks after onset of weakness. • Inclusion of patients transferred from another hospital if the stay in the first hospital was less than one week. In IGOS-Infections patients can still be included if the stay in another hospital was more than one week. • Opportunity to conduct a follow-up of at least one year. In IGOS-Infections and IGOS-Zika opportunity to follow-up at least 6 months. • In IGOS-Infections: suspected antecedent infection related to GBS. • Informed consent of the patient or, in case of children, of the parents or legal guardiansCriteria for inclusion of patients in the optional research modules of the IGOS: Additional informed consent is required for each optional research module: (1) CSF biomarkers: additional volume obtained at diagnostic spinal tap (2) Long-term outcome: additional clinical assessments at two and three years gelijk n

Design outcomes

Primary

MeasureTime frame
IGOS will result in a large combined clinical database and biobank of patients with GBS with all the variants and subtypes. Expertise Groups will use this data/biobank to determine the processes that determine and predicts disease progression and recovery in GBS. This information will be used to develop predictive models that can predict the clinical course in individual patients with GBS. These prognostic models can guide selective therapeutic trails in the future with specific subtypes of patients to personalize the treatment and improve the prognosis of GBS. The main outcome measures for the clinical course are the GBS disability score, MRC sum score, Overall Neuropathy Limitations Scale (ONLS), Rasch-built Overall Disability Scale(R-ODS), Fatigue Severity Scale(FSS) en EurQoL. For children (IGOS-kids) the following outcome measures will be: GBS disability score, MRC sum score, GBS-kids score, Peds-QL, Peds-QL MFS, ACTIVLIM, FSS and ONLS dependent of the age of the patient. (See supplement 19 of the protocol) IGOS will be divided in expertise groups that will focus on specific research areas, including: • Prognostic modelling : development of models to predict clinical course and outcome • Treatment interventions : defining treatment practice, effects and side-effects • Pharmacokinetics of IVIg : defining serum IgG levels after IVIg in relation to outcome • Electrophysiology : prognostic relevance of electrophysiological classification • Preceding events : defining type of infections/vaccinations related to GBS and outcome • Anti-neural antibodies : characterisation of serum antibodies related to GBS and outcome • CSF biomarkers : proteomic studies of CSF in relation to GBS and outcome • Genetic markers : genetic studies to define polymorphisms related to GBS and outcome • Paediatric GBS : characterisation of clinical course and outcome in children with GBS (IGOS-Kids) • Long-term outcome : residual disability and impact 2 and 3

Besides the above clinical outcome measures IGOS will investigate several other GBS-related clinical effects, including autonomic dysfunction, and transition to chronic inflammatory demyelinating polyneuropathy.
